Thermodynamic optimization of finned crossflow heat exchangers for aircraft environmental control systems

TLDR
In this paper, the main geometric features of a flow component can be deduced from the thermodynamic optimization of the global performance of the largest flow system that incorporates the component, and the method illustrated in this paper is applicable to any system that runs on the basis of a limited amount of fuel (exergy) installed onboard.
